Poke Cafe — Restaurant in Seattle

Name
Poke Cafe
Description
Informal counter-service cafe serving create-your-own Hawaiian poke bowls plus bubble tea drinks.

Owners seem to be very nice and were very excited for business after being closed for eight weeks. Great location as I occasionally run to Northgate/Target for errands and there aren’t many places serving poke in the area. Great indoor and outdoor seating!

I ordered a “mostly salad” poke bowl with brown rice, tuna+salmon and all sides. I thought the amount of fish was great and the ingredients tasted fresh. Unlike other poke places with 5+ protein and flavor options, they keep it simple offering tuna, shrimp, octopus, tofu and salmon and classic, spicy or ponzu dressing. I didn’t taste a lot of mayo and I appreciated that!

Poke aside, I love that they also offer banh mi (Vietnamese subs) as well as rice/vermicelli bowls and bubble tea! Their black tea has some nice vanilla undertones and I was so pleased that I could order a drink with my preferred sweetness level (1/2 the sugar). I will...
